Is Bellevue rich?

Seattle-Tacoma-Bellevue is the wealthiest metro area on the West Coast outside of California. Most households in the metro area earn at least $82,000 a year, and 12% of households earn at least $200,000 annually.

Is Bellevue cheaper than Seattle?

Bellevue is 14.0% more expensive than Seattle. Bellevue housing costs are 26.7% more expensive than Seattle housing costs. Health related expenses are 0.0% less in Bellevue.

What is Bellevue known for?

Bellevue is the high-tech and retail center of the Eastside, with more than 150,000 jobs and a downtown skyline of gleaming high-rises. With beautiful parks, top schools and a vibrant economy, Bellevue is routinely ranked among the best mid-sized cities in the country.
